CHRISTMAS TREE CUPCAKES



Christmas Tree Cupcakes image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 1h30m

Yield 12 cupcakes

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 cup malted milk powder (original, not chocolate-flavored)
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
3/4 cup whole milk
1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
1/2 cup granulated sugar
3/4 cup vegetable oil
1 large egg
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
4 tablespoons salted butter, at room temperature
6 ounces cream cheese, at room temperature
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
2 cups confectioners' sugar
White nonpareils, for decorating (optional)
Candy-melt trees, for decorating

Steps:

  • Make the cupcakes: Preheat the oven to 350˚. Line a 12-cup muffin pan with paper or foil liners. Whisk the flour, malted milk powder and baking soda in a medium bowl.
  • Heat the milk until hot but not boiling; pour over the cocoa powder in a large bowl and whisk until smooth. Let cool slightly.
  • Whisk the granulated sugar, vegetable oil, egg and vanilla into the cocoa mixture until smooth. Whisk in the flour mixture until just combined.
  • Divide the batter among the prepared muffin cups. Bake until the tops spring back when gently pressed, 20 to 25 minutes. Transfer to a rack and let cool 5 minutes in the pan, then remove the cupcakes to the rack to cool completely.
  • Meanwhile, make the frosting: Beat the butter, cream cheese and vanilla in a large bowl with a mixer on medium speed until creamy, 1 to 2 minutes. Gradually beat in the confectioners' sugar on medium-low speed until smooth, then increase the speed to medium high and beat until thick and fluffy, 1 to 2 more minutes.
  • Spread the frosting on the cupcakes and sprinkle with white nonpareils. Stick a candy-melt tree into the center of each cupcake.

CUPCAKE CHRISTMAS TREE



Cupcake Christmas Tree image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 1h50m

Yield 20 to 25 servings

Number Of Ingredients 25

Paper mini cupcake liners
2 cups sugar
1 3/4 cups flour
3/4 cup cocoa powder
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da
1 teaspoon salt
2 eggs
1 cup whole milk
1/2 cup vegetable oil
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1 teaspoon almond extract
1 cup boiling water
8 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ened at room temperature
1 pound confectioners' sugar
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
2 to 4 tablespoons whole milk
Green sprinkles or jimmies
1 small 11-inch styrofoam cone (you can get this at a craft shop or in the craft department of a large discount store)
30 to 40 toothpicks
10 small candy canes
1/2 cup fresh cranberries
Gold leaf
Gold and red curling ribbon
Sugar, for snow

Steps:

  • Cupcakes: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F. Line the cups of 2 to 4 mini muffin tins with paper liners (you can bake the cupcakes in batches if necessary). Mix the sugar, fl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t together in a mixer fitted with a whisk attachment. Add the eggs and milk and mix until well combined. Drizzle in the oil and the vanilla and almond extracts and mix. With the mixer running at low speed, add the boiling water and mix just until smooth. Fill the lined muffin cups about 2/3 full. Bake until risen and firm to the touch, about 20 minutes. Let cool in the pans. Frosting: In a mixer fitted with a paddle attachment (or using a hand mixer), cream the butter until smooth. Add the sugar, vanilla, and 2 tablespoons milk and mix until smooth. Add more milk a little at a time until the frosting is thick and spreadable. Using a flexible spatula, frost the tops of the cooled cupcakes. Refrigerate at least 1 hour before assembling the tree.
  • To assemble the tree, spread a thick layer of sprinkles out on a plate. Dip the tops of the cupcakes in the sprinkles and set aside. Tie curling ribbon around the candy canes and curl with a scissor blade. One inch up from the bottom of the styrofoam cone, stick toothpicks into the cone 1 1/2 inches apart, making a circle around the cone and leaving them sticking out at least 1 inch. Place the cone on a serving platter. Make the bottom ring of cupcakes by spearing the bottom of a cupcake onto one of the toothpicks in the cone, with the frosting facing out and with the side of the cupcake resting on the plate. One inch above the tops of the first row of cupcakes, place another row of toothpicks 1 1/2 inches apart, all around the cone, positioning them so that the second row will rest between the tops of the first row. You will fit fewer cupcakes on the second row; feel free to cut a cupcake in half if necessary to fit into the space available. Spear the cupcakes onto the toothpicks as before. Continue up the cone to form a tree of cupcakes, ending with a single cupcake on top. Serve within one hour, or refrigerate up to 24 hours. Stick the candy canes in the styrofoam and stick gilded cranberries on with a little extra icing. Pour sugar on the serving platter around the tree. To gild the cranberries, roll them on the sheets of gold leaf to roughly coat.

CHRISTMAS TREE CUPCAKES



Christmas Tree Cupcakes image

Serve this snowy dessert this holiday season. Cupcakes are shaped like trees, covered with snowy frosting, and sprinkled with sanding sugar. Save some sugar to create beds of "snow" for serving. If you like, you can also make mini gingerbread stars to decorate the tops of the trees.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es     Cupcake Recipes

Yield Makes 1 dozen

Number Of Ingredients 14

12 sugar cones (2 to 2 1/2 inches wide and 4 to 5 inches long)
3/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der, preferably Dutch-process
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1 1/2 cups granulated sugar
1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da
3/4 teaspoon baking powder
3/4 teaspoon coarse salt
2 large eggs
1 1/2 cups warm water
3/4 cup buttermilk
1/4 cup plus 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
3/4 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
Frosting for Christmas Tree Cupcakes
Fine sanding sugar, for sprinkling

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ees. Invert two 9 1/2-by-3-inch disposable round foil baking pans. Using a craft knife or a paring knife, cut six X shapes in bottom of each, spacing them evenly, to make 1 1/2-inch openings. Fit a waffle cone snugly into each opening, standing the cones upright. Line each cone with parchment paper, and then place a dried bean or a hazelnut in bottom to prevent batter from leaking. Place pans and cones on parchment-lined baking sheets. Line a 12-cup mini-muffin tin with paper liners.
  • Whisk together cocoa powder, flour, sugar, baking soda, baking powder, and salt in a large bowl. Whisk together eggs, warm water, buttermilk, oil, and vanilla in a medium bowl. With a mixer on low speed, gradually add egg mixture to flour mixture, beating until just combined. Raise speed to medium, and beat for 3 minutes. Carefully pour batter into cones, filling each two-thirds full. Spoon 1 1/2 tablespoons batter into each muffin cup (these will be the tree bases).
  • Bake until a skewer inserted into center of cake comes out clean, 15 to 18 minutes for cupcakes and 35 minutes for cones. Let cakes cool on a wire rack for 15 minutes. Remove cakes from cones and parchment. Let cool completely on the rack.
  • If necessary, use a serrated knife to trim top of each cupcake to create a flat surface. Place a dab of frosting on top of each cupcake, and position a cone cake on top. Place frosting in a pastry bag fitted with a small star tip (such as Ateco #19) and pipe frosting decoratively all over tree. Sprinkle with sanding sugar. Top each tree with a mini gingerbread star, if desired. Trees can be refrigerated, uncovered, for up to 6 hours before serving.

CHRISTMAS TREE CUPCAKES



Christmas Tree Cupcakes image

Need a festive Christmas cupcake in a hurry? Pipe green frosting on your favorite cupcakes in the shape of a Christmas tree and decorate with an array of sweets and sprinkles as Christmas ornaments.

Provided by Kris

Categories     Desserts     Cakes     Holiday Cake Recipes

Time 1h

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 ½ cups vanilla frosting, divided
12 unfrosted cupcakes
2 drops green food coloring, or as needed
¼ cup sprinkles, colored sugar, or candies
12 unfrosted cupcakes, cooled

Steps:

  • Spoon 1/2 cup vanilla frosting into a bowl. Spread a thin layer over the top of each cupcake with a knife. Refrigerate cupcakes for 30 minutes to make decorating easier.
  • Combine remaining 2 cups of vanilla frosting and green food coloring in a bowl; stir until frosting is uniformly green. Add more green food coloring, 1 drop at a time, until your frosting is the color you like.
  • Transfer frosting to a piping bag. Working perpendicular to the top of each cupcake, pipe the green frosting around the edge, working inwards in a circular motion to create a tree shape. Repeat with remaining cupcakes.
  • Decorate Christmas trees with sprinkles, colored sugar, or candies as the "ornaments" on the trees.

CUPCAKE CHRISTMAS TREE



Cupcake Christmas Tree image

Heather McKinley of Mechanic Falls, Maine shared this minty twist on typical cupcakes, then our Test Kitchen arranged them in a tree shape for a pretty presentation. The star on the top of the tree and cute packages tucked beneath are a snap to make with colorful candies.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h5m

Yield 23 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 package devil's food cake mix (regular size)
1-1/2 cups mint chocolate chips
6 tablespoons butter, softened
2-2/3 cups confectioners' sugar
4 to 5 tablespoons milk
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/4 teaspoon peppermint extract
1 teaspoon baking cocoa
1/4 teaspoon green paste food coloring
Candy-coated milk chocolate miniature kisses
2 chocolate stars
12 Starburst candies

Steps:

  • Prepare cake batter mix according to package directions for cupcakes; fold in chips. Fill foil-lined muffin cups two-thirds full. , Bake at 350° for 18-24 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ool for 5 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ks to cool completely., For frosting, in a large bowl, cream butter and confectioners' s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in milk and extracts until blended. Transfer 2 tablespoons to a small bowl; stir in cocoa. Stir green food coloring into remaining frosting. , Frost 21 cupcakes with green frosting; arrange in a pyramid to form a tree. Decorate all but the top cupcake with miniature kisses for lights. Frost two cupcakes with chocolate frosting and place at base of tree for trunk; top each with a chocolate star. Save remaining cupcake for another use., With a rolling pin, roll two yellow Starburst candies flat; cut with 2-in. and 1-1/2-in. star-shaped cookie cutters. Press smaller star onto larger star; place on cupcake at top of tree. , For presents, roll five Starburst candies into 3x3/4-in. rectangles; cut each rectangle into four 3-in.-long strips. Place two strips widthwise on one whole Starburst candy; press together at base to attach. , For bow, form two strips into figure eights; press together in center and press onto wrapped candy. Repeat with remaining strips and remaining four whole Starburst candies. Place presents beneath cupcake tree.

CHRISTMAS TREE MINI CUPCAKES



Christmas Tree Mini Cupcakes image

These are a delicious treat for the holidays, after a day the juice from the strawberry gets absorbed by the cupcake. Yummy!

Provided by britt98

Categories     Desserts     Cakes     Holiday Cake Recipes

Time 48m

Yield 48

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 ½ cups pastry flour
1 cup white sugar
⅓ cup cocoa powder
1 cup water
½ cup vegetable oil
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up vanilla frosting, or as desired
1 drop green food coloring, or as desired
48 small strawberries, hulled
¼ cup round red candies, or as desired
star-shaped candies

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ease mini muffin cups or line with paper liners.
  • Mix pastry flour, white sugar, and cocoa powder together in a bowl; add water, oil, and vanilla extract and blend until batter is smooth. Spoon batter into the prepared muffin cups.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, 8 to 12 minutes. Cool in the tin for 5 minutes.
  • Mix frosting and green food coloring together in a bowl until evenly combined. Transfer frosting to a pipe bag or plastic bag with a snipped corner; refrigerate for 5 minutes.
  • Squeeze a small amount of frosting onto the hulled side of each strawberry and place each onto a cupcake so the strawberry is in the shape of a tree. Pipe frosting onto each strawberry to look like leaves. Add candies to the "tree" to look like ornaments and place a star-shaped candy on top of each "tree".

CHRISTMAS TREE CUPCAKES



Christmas Tree Cupcakes image

I found a Christmas tree cupcake pan at a local supermarket and decided to make them using the Easy White Cake recipe from the recipe booklet which came with my new (Christmas gift) KitchenAid mixer. They were fun to make and messy to frost. LOL Having more than one pan would definately have speeded things up. I decorated the trees with some star-shaped Christmas candies. I also dropped some of the candies into the batter before baking, which gave some of the cupcakes a color-spotted inside. The round cake bits which resulted from cutting off the cupcake "humps" make nice, bite size, sandwich 'cookies' when put together with extra frosting. Spread the frosting on the flat side of one round and cover with another.

Provided by Sandaidh

Categories     Dessert

Time 50m

Yield 20 cupcakes

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 cups all-purpose flour
1 1/2 cups sugar
3 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up shortening
1 cup nonfat milk
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
4 egg whites

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F.
  • Combine all dry ingredients in mixer bowl.
  • Add shortening, milk and vanilla.
  • Mix for about 1 minute.
  • Stop and scrape bowl.
  • Add egg whites.
  • Beat until smooth and fluffy.
  • Fill greased and floured cupcake molds about halfway.
  • Bake in preheated oven for about 20 minutes, or until toothpick inserted into center comes out clean.
  • Remove from oven.
  • Slice rounded"humps" from cupcakes.
  • Cool on wire racks.
  • Frost with green frosting and decorate.
